FAQsI already have OpManager. Why do I need the NCM plug-in?OpManager helps you to monitor health, availability, and performance of all devices on your network. Using the NCM plug-in, you can manage configurations, take control of configuration changes, ensure compliance to government and industry regulations, and automate all repetitive and time-consuming NCCM (Network Change and Configuration Management) tasks. How is the NCM plug-in licensed?OpManager's NCM plug-in is licensed based on the number of network devices. You have the option of purchasing a license for the required number of supported devices. What installation platforms are supported?For now, NCM plug-in supports only Windows installation (.exe). Does the NCM plug-in needs a separate database?NCM plug-in uses the same MySQL instance of OpManager for storing the collected data. Note: NCM plug-in does not support MS-SQL as of now.
